Embracing Change: Bridging the Gap Between Urbanites and Rural Communities

The transition from a bustling metropolis to a tranquil countryside can be both exciting and daunting. Moving from a big city to a small county town is not just a change of scenery but also a profound shift in culture. This migration brings about a dynamic interplay of traditions, values, and lifestyles. In order to create a harmonious community, it is essential for both sides to understand, accept, and adapt to the differences that come with this cultural shift.

Understanding the Urban-Rural Cultural Divide

Big cities are often characterized by their fast-paced lifestyles, diverse populations, and a plethora of amenities. In contrast, small county towns usually have tight-knit communities, slower rhythms, and a strong emphasis on local traditions. When individuals from these disparate backgrounds come together, conflicts can arise due to differing expectations and norms.

Challenges Faced by Urbanites

  1. Adapting to a Slower Pace: Urbanites might find it challenging to adjust to the relaxed pace of life in a small town. Patience and an open mind are crucial during this adjustment period.

  2. Cultural Differences: Rural areas often have deep-rooted customs and traditions. Urbanites need to approach these with respect and a willingness to learn, even if they seem unfamiliar or unconventional.

  3. Limited Amenities: Small towns might not offer the same conveniences as big cities. Urbanites need to be prepared for fewer entertainment options and be willing to engage in local activities.

Challenges Faced by Rural Communities

  1. Acceptance and Integration: Rural communities might be wary of newcomers, fearing that their way of life could be disrupted. It’s essential for them to be open to accepting new people and ideas, realizing that diversity can enrich their community.

  2. Infrastructure and Development: Small towns may need to adapt their infrastructure to accommodate an influx of residents. This could mean investing in better housing, healthcare facilities, and educational institutions.

  3. Preservation of Local Culture: While embracing change, it’s vital for rural communities to preserve their unique culture and heritage. This can be achieved through community events, local festivals, and education programs.

Building a Happy Community: What Needs to Happen

  1. Promoting Cultural Exchange: Organize events that encourage cultural exchange, where urbanites and locals can share their traditions, food, and stories. This fosters understanding and helps break down stereotypes.

  2. Investing in Education: Education is key to bridging the cultural gap. Implement educational programs in schools and community centers that promote tolerance, diversity, and inclusivity.

  3. Supporting Local Businesses: Encourage urbanites to support local businesses. This not only stimulates the local economy but also fosters a sense of community and belonging.

  4. Active Participation: Encourage active participation of both newcomers and locals in community projects and initiatives. Working together towards common goals creates bonds and a shared sense of purpose.

  5. Open Communication: Foster open and respectful communication between different groups. Encourage town hall meetings, forums, and discussions where concerns can be addressed and ideas shared.

In CLosing:

Embracing change when people move from a big city to a small county town requires effort, understanding, and patience from both sides. By acknowledging and appreciating the differences, while also finding common ground, urbanites and rural communities can coexist harmoniously. Through cultural exchange, education, and active participation, a happy and integrated community can be built where everyone feels valued and respected, regardless of their background or origin.
